I also have a LaserJet 4100 at the office, and I face various issues
related to tray selection, but they are different in each
application/printing framework:

* OpenOffice allows to set "Tray 3" and "Tray 4" to "Installed" in the advanced 
printer options, but I have to activate tray 4 and choose this when I want to 
print on tray 3.
* The GTK print dialog (e.g., Evolution) lets me choose only the built-in trays 
1 and 2, not the optional trays 3 or 4. There is no option to activate these 
trays in the advanced options.
* The GNOME print dialog (e.g., Tomboy) lets me choose trays 1 to 4, although 
tray 4 is not installed (which seems to be better than not to be able to choose 
these at all).
